EL Paso, Texas - A goal by UTEP's Brandi Aston in the 18th minute proved to be the game winner, as UTEP slipped past the Bears, 1-0 at University Field in El Paso on Friday night.
With the loss, Baylor drops to 0-1 while the Miners improve to 1-0.
"We came out a little flat and it hurt us," head coach Marci Jobson said. "I think we have to learn from that and improve, and I think we will do both of those things this week."
UTEP got the game's lone goal at the 17:43 mark when Aston stole the ball from a Baylor defender and hit a well placed shot past a diving Gianna Quintana.
Baylor upped the pressure in the second half, posting a pair of shots that nearly got the Bears on the board. In the 82nd minute, sophomore Lotto Smith rose up above a crowd and got her head on the ball and on goal, only to be thwarted by a Miner defender.
The Miners took nine shots, with only three on goal, while the Bears were credited with two shots and one on goal.
Baylor will be back in action on Aug. 29 as it travels to Albuquerque, N.M., to face New Mexico at 8 p.m. CT.
